Fintiri condemns Boko Haram attack in Garkida

Governor Ahmadu Umaru Fintiri has condemned the Boko Haram attack on Garkida town in Gombi local area of Adamawa state.

The attack occurred when Boko Haram fighters attacked Garkida on Thursday, causing the death of two civilians including a 5-year-old, an eyewitness said on Friday.

“This latest cowardly attack on Gombi town is yet another desperate rear guard action by the Boko Haram terrorists who have been under intense pressure from the Nigerian military,” Mr Fintiri said, on Friday, according to a statement by his spokesperson, Humwashi Wonosikou .

According to the statement, Mr Fintiri condemned “the dastardly attack.”

“Let me reassured Adamawa residents that this latest cowardly attack on Garkida, would not go without severe consequences.

Fintiri sympathised with residents of Garkida over the unfortunate Christmas Eve attack, calling on security agencies to do more further attacks in the state.
